Name[edit]
Lebetus Winther, 1877: 49
Type species: Gobius scorpioides ♂ Collett, 1874. Type by monotypy.
Synonyms[edit]
- Butigobius Whitley, 1930: 123
- Lebistes (subgenus of Gobius) Smitt, 1900: 487
